What is UnixWare?

Xinuos has unveiled UnixWare® 7.1.4, the latest iteration of its renowned UNIX® operating system. This powerful and dependable platform is crafted to support vital business applications while being budget-friendly for various computing needs. It is designed to work seamlessly with contemporary industry-standard hardware and peripherals, showcasing improved performance, scalability, and reliability—key features synonymous with the UnixWare brand. Furthermore, the default settings of the most popular versions have been fine-tuned to maximize their appeal. Users initiating new setups or upgrading to UnixWare 7.1.4 will immediately benefit from these enhancements. A new economical edition has also been launched, specifically aimed at low-cost pilot initiatives, edge computing applications, and services for smaller businesses. This advancement guarantees that even smaller enterprises can leverage state-of-the-art technology without incurring hefty expenses. With these developments, Xinuos continues to demonstrate its commitment to providing flexible and innovative solutions for businesses of all sizes.

What is Red Hat Enterprise Linux?

Red Hat Enterprise Linux is a powerful operating system tailored for business environments, boasting a wide range of certifications across various cloud platforms and numerous vendors. It provides a stable foundation that promotes uniformity across diverse settings while supplying users with crucial tools to expedite the delivery of services and workloads for multiple applications. By reducing deployment hurdles and costs, Red Hat Enterprise Linux accelerates the realization of value for critical workloads, promoting collaboration and innovation among development and operations teams in different environments. In addition, it strengthens hybrid cloud infrastructures by extending functionalities to edge locations, serving hundreds of thousands of nodes worldwide. Users have the ability to create optimized OS images for edge computing, limit disruptions due to OS updates, perform system updates more effectively, and take advantage of automatic health checks and rollback options. Moreover, specialized command line utilities are provided to facilitate inventory management and remediation tasks associated with subscription upgrades or migrations from other Linux distributions, ensuring a smooth and efficient transition. This adaptability not only empowers organizations to efficiently oversee their IT resources but also positions them to thrive in an ever-evolving technological landscape, making Red Hat Enterprise Linux a crucial ally in digital transformation.
